Biography
Joon Kang taught himself the piano at the age of 18. Two years later, he earned a scholarship to Berklee College of Music. Joon has performed and recorded with keyboard legends Don Randi and Matt Rollings and has studied with six world-class pianists: Nikolai Mishchenko, Alain Mallet, Robert Christopherson, Laszlo Gardony, Jason Yeager, and John Paul McGee. Joon holds a Bachelor’s in Songwriting from Berklee College of Music. As a teacher, Joon is passionate about helping students develop a relationship with their inner creative voice and express their emotions with music. In addition to teaching, performing, and writing songs, Joon is completing a Master’s degree in Piano at Berklee NYC.
Teaching Philosophy
To teach means more than to pass down one’s knowledge: It is to mentor and facilitate growth, like a gardener attending to his garden, and to pass on one’s spirit and joy to one’s students. Since every student is unique, for students to grow on both musical and personal levels, one-size-fits-all pedagogy is not ideal. It is my personal mission to truly get to know each student and understand what makes them unique, and then create a tailored program for them based on their goals. My goal is to help unlock each student’s creative voice, enable them to translate that into music on the piano, and play with total freedom and expression.
